Shafts have been found inside the north and south partitions of the Queen's Chamber in 1872 by British engineer Waynman Dixon, who believed shafts similar to These inside the King's Chamber need to also exist. The shafts were not linked to the outer faces of your pyramid or maybe the Queen's Chamber; their intent is not known. In a single shaft Dixon identified a ball of diorite, a bronze hook of unfamiliar objective along with a bit of cedar wood.

Ahead of the construction of the primary pyramids, the men and women of historical Egypt buried their lifeless in structures referred to as mastabas. These flat-roofed, rectangular buildings were being crafted from mud-brick and served as tombs for that elite associates of society.
